Stalemate at Estádio Municipal: FC Famalicão and Rio Ave Battle to a 0-0 Draw

In the heart of Liga Portugal’s 2025 season, FC Famalicão faced off against Rio Ave at the Estádio Municipal de Famalicão on 28 September. The match unfolded as a tactical chess game, culminating in a goalless draw that left both sets of supporters yearning for that elusive breakthrough.

Despite the absence of goals, the encounter was far from uneventful. FC Famalicão's Gil Dias and Sorriso were particularly active in the attacking third, each trying to break the deadlock with a series of attempts on goal. However, Rio Ave's defensive line, supported by their goalkeeper, stood resolute, blocking and saving every effort. Lazar Carevic, Famalicão's own custodian, mirrored this defensive prowess with crucial saves, notably denying a dangerous shot from Rio Ave's Andr Luiz. His performance was a testament to the old adage that a good goalkeeper can be worth his weight in gold.

A moment of tension arose in the 29th minute when Famalicão's Rafa Soares received a yellow card for a reckless foul. This early caution seemed to inject a more cautious approach into the home side’s play, yet they continued to carve out offensive opportunities. The match's competitive nature was reflected in Famalicão's determination to regain their footing after a 1-2 home loss to Sporting CP earlier in September.

This result in Jornada 7 ensured that Famalicão maintained their unbeaten home record for the year 2025, a stat that underscores their fortress-like resilience at Estádio Municipal. The draw, while frustrating in terms of missed opportunities, kept them steady in the league standings, showcasing a blend of traditional grit and modern resilience.
